First Vessel To Benefit in Raymarine and RNLI Partnership

RNLI vessels have historically used a system known as SIMS (Systems and Information Management System); this electronic integrated bridge system allows lifeboat crew to monitor, operate, and control various functions directly from their seats, including navigation, radio communications and engine management. 

Following the RNLI’s announcement that Teledyne Raymarine were successful in their tender for the SIMS replacement program, both parties wanted to make a positive start, and the first project was to initiate the Raymarine refit on the Shannon class (AWL) All Weather Lifeboat.

The Shannon is the RNLI’s latest all-weather lifeboat with a top-speed of 25 knots and a survivor capacity of 61. The fleet of 68 vessels around the UK and Ireland is highly versatile for undertaking SAR (Search and Rescue) operations in any conditions. 

The RNLI had the Shannon relief vessel 'ON1333' available, so this would be the first vessel for the refit campaign.

A Full Electronics Refit

The scope of the SIMS system replacement is for a full uplift of navigation electronics to adopt and embrace the capabilities offered by the latest generation of Teledyne Raymarine equipment. To support this program, Raymarine has fitted products from the Teledyne Raymarine, FLIR Marine, and Raymarine Commercial product lines.

  • SV-ECS Electronic Chart System - this electronic chart system was specifically developed in line with RNLI specifications to incorporate search and rescue patterns, radar overlay, auto-routing, split-screen capabilities, and directional rangefinder integration, whilst remaining compliant to MCA regulations.

The Shannon class is designed to withstand the worst conditions, and this new system fit out took time to design and install, but the process was completed in April 2026.   

Following the successful sea trials on ON1333, Teledyne Raymarine will now be moving forwards to initiate the full refit campaign for the Shannon class and are expecting for all vessels to be completed by autumn 2029.
